
总结 本文介绍了两种将一维 NumPy 数组重塑为接近正方形的二维矩阵的方法。 定期检查路由和文件系统配置,以确保其正常工作。 推荐使用ICU、utf8cpp或Boost.Locale等库实现跨平台Unicode操作,如utf8cpp可迭代码点。 这些库通常提供更丰富的特性,如非阻塞I/O(在某些配...

核心思路是合理划分模块边界,统一版本控制,并利用工具减少冗余和冲突。 auto start = std::chrono::steady_clock::now(); // 执行某些操作... auto end = std::chrono::steady_clock::now(); auto durat...

避免设计过于细碎的命令,当多个操作在业务上紧密相关时,考虑使用复合命令。 性能优化: CDN: 对于常用库(如jQuery),考虑使用CDN链接,可以进一步提升加载速度。 性能高效: 避免了append可能导致的切片底层数组的重新分配和数据复制,尤其当切片容量与长度一致时。 它清晰地表达了“计算子和...

本文详细介绍了如何在现有SQL分组查询中,通过巧妙利用聚合函数SUM()实现条件计数,例如统计每个司机的未请假缺勤次数。 当 ntimes 调用 action() 时,实际上就是调用了 obj.hello()。 这通常是由于API配额限制造成的。 如果只是防止修改变量,且值可能来自运行时输入,则用 ...

API设计: 需要仔细设计字段结构API的响应格式,使其既能提供足够的信息供前端渲染,又不过于臃肿。 8 查看详情 基本语法: while (条件) { // 循环体 } 示例:当变量小于等于5时输出 $i = 1; while ($i echo $i . "<br>";...

适用于已知格式正确或不关心合规性的场景。 传统方法的局限性 为了解决上述问题,常见的尝试包括: 直接使用bisect_left(name): 这种方法会因为str和Supplier类型不兼容而报错,因为SortedList的key函数只影响排序,不改变bisect_left在内部进行比较时的数据类型...

例如,要添加 'attendee_name' 键和对应的值,应该这样做: 怪兽AI数字人 数字人短视频创作,数字人直播,实时驱动数字人 44 查看详情 $shortcode['attendee_name'] = $tickets[0]['shortcode_data']['attendee_name...

if all(sum(y) >= x for x, *y in zip(result, *comb)):: 这是核心的条件检查部分。 防止反序列化漏洞:虽然json_decode()本身不会直接导致PHP反序列化漏洞(因为这不是PHP的unserialize()),但如果解码后的数据被用于构建...

另外,现代C++编译器对异常处理的实现进行了优化,使得在没有异常抛出时,异常处理的开销非常小。 例如: 立即学习“go语言免费学习笔记(深入)”; func (d *Dog) Bark() string { return "Bark! I'm " + d.Name } 此时,*Dog类型实现了Bar...

解决方案 解决此类问题的关键在于确保数据在整个流程中都使用一致的UTF-8编码。 Python 代码实现 以下是使用 Python 实现矩阵行阶梯形变换的示例代码。 基本上就这些。 ### 1. 利用`print`语句进行初步调试 `print`语句是最简单直接的调试工具。 内部辅助函数可加下划线前...